Microchip ATMEGA169PA-MU: An 8-bit AVR Powerhouse with Integrated LCD Control
The Microchip ATMEGA169PA-MU stands as a highly integrated and capable member of the renowned AVR microcontroller family. This 8-bit powerhouse is specifically engineered for applications demanding a user interface, combining robust general-purpose control with the specialized ability to drive LCD displays directly. Its combination of processing power, extensive peripherals, and built-in display control makes it an ideal solution for a vast array of consumer, industrial, and automotive products.
At its core, the microcontroller operates on the advanced AVR RISC architecture, executing powerful instructions in a single clock cycle. This allows the ATMEGA169PA-MU to achieve throughputs approaching 1 MIPS per MHz, enabling efficient and speedy operation for complex control tasks. It is equipped with 16KB of in-system self-programmable Flash memory, 1KB of SRAM, and 512Bytes of EEPROM, providing ample space for program code, variable storage, and data retention.
The defining feature of this component is its integrated LCD controller. This peripheral can directly drive up to 4 commons and 25 segments, facilitating the creation of rich interfaces without the need for an external driver IC. This significantly reduces system complexity, board space, and overall bill-of-materials cost for designs incorporating alphanumeric or custom segmented displays.
Beyond its display capabilities, the microcontroller is packed with a comprehensive set of peripherals, creating a true system-on-chip solution. It includes:

Two 8-bit and two 16-bit Timer/Counters with PWM capabilities.
A versatile 10-channel, 10-bit ADC for precision analog sensor measurements.
Programmable Watchdog Timer and Brown-out Detection circuitry for enhanced reliability in electrically noisy environments.
Multiple serial communication interfaces, including USART, SPI, and a Two-wire Serial Interface (I²C).
Housed in a compact 44-pad QFN (MU) package, the device is designed for space-constrained applications. Its wide operating voltage range of 1.8V to 5.5V and a suite of power-saving sleep modes make it exceptionally well-suited for battery-powered and low-energy devices.
